Dietary intake of total, heme and non-heme iron and the risk of colorectal cancer in a European prospective cohort study
Background Iron is an essential micronutrient with differing intake patterns and metabolism between men and women. Epidemiologic evidence on the association of dietary iron and its heme and non-heme components with colorectal cancer (CRC) development is inconclusive.
